Article from Earth & Fork: Noble has been on my "to eat" list for a while, and I scoped out their menu and found that they had a short, tight brunch menu. This usually is my style, and gets me excited, because more often than not it turns out to be a more controlled menu, with thought-out dishes. And, that's pretty much what Noble is - a pretty solid spot studded with lots of local ingredient love.
Our Sunday brunch jaunt was amid darkened clouds looming in the distance and a humid, sticky day. Not to worry, as the bartender promised me his "best drink ever" as I sucked down a tarragon, strawberry mojito. Maybe not the best ever, but it was refreshing, and a weird mix of savory and sweet.
